Mesomorphism of some Alkoxynaphthoic Acids

Abstract

THE existence of mesophases in the melts of p-n-alkoxybenzoic and p-n-alkoxycinnamic acids has already been established1,2. In these acids the length of the rod-shaped molecules is enhanced by hydrogen-bond formation, and the mesomorphism arises from the association of the acids in double molecules. In this way, p-n-propoxybenzoic acid, which has the simplest molecular structure yet found to give a mesomorphic form, acquires a structure which is similar in length and shape to that of a typical nematic compound, such as azoxyanisole.
